What it does

  • Allows you to find specific Production Plans by plan number, production item, date range, status, or other attributes
  • Provides filtering and sorting options in the Production Plan List view for precise results
  • Lets you save custom views and filters for recurring searches
Prerequisites
  • At least one Production Plan exists under Manufacturing > Production Plan > Production Plan List.
  • You know at least one search criterion (e.g., plan number, production item, status, date).

1.0 Open the Production Plan List

  1. From the main menu, navigate to Manufacturing > Production Plan > Production Plan List.
  2. The list view displays all submitted and draft Production Plans with columns such as:
    • Plan No.
    • Production Item
    • Planned Qty
    • Start Date / End Date
    • Status (Draft, Submitted, On Hold, Cancelled)

1.2 Apply Filters for Granular Results

  1. Click Filter > Add Filter (usually located above the column headers).
  2. Select a filter field from the dropdown. Common filters include:
    • Plan No. (exact or partial match)
    • Production Item (e.g., “Ovita Water Bottling”)
    • Status (Draft, Submitted, On Hold, Cancelled)
    • Start Date / End Date (e.g., plans starting in Q2 2025)
    • Priority (High, Medium, Low)
  3. Choose the operator (e.g., =, >=, <=, like) and enter the value.
  4. Click Apply. You can add multiple filters to narrow results further (e.g., Production Item = “Danaval Bread” AND Status = “Submitted”).
To find plans that start after a certain date, set:> - Field: Start Date> - Operator: >> - Value: 2025-04-01

1.3 Sort and Customize Columns

  1. To sort, hover over a column header (e.g., Start Date or Plan No.) and click the up/down arrow that appears.
  2. To add or remove columns, click the three-dot menu (⋮) next to the column headers and choose Customize Columns.
  3. Check or uncheck fields like Priority, Planned Qty, or Comments to tailor the view.
  4. Click Apply to update the display.

1.4 Save and Reuse Filtered Views

  1. After applying your desired filters and sorting, click Save Filter (usually at the bottom of the filter panel).
  2. Give the filter set a descriptive name (e.g., “Q2 2025 High Priority”).
  3. Click Save.
  4. In future sessions, open Production Plan List, click Filter > Saved, and select your saved filter to reapply quickly.

1.5 Open the Production Plan Profile

  1. Once you locate the desired plan in the list, click the Plan No. link.
  2. The full Production Plan form opens in read-only mode (or edit mode if you have permissions).
  3. Review or modify details as needed—fields like Planned Qty, Start Date, End Date, BOM, and Priority.
